540-acre farm with trails, creeks, animals & nearby attractions
Escape to a cozy retreat nestled in a quiet holler on our 540-acre Red Haven Farm. Surrounded by forest, creeks, and starry skies, this peaceful haven is perfect for unplugging and recharging—yet still offers Wi-Fi when you need it.
What You’ll Love: - Total privacy with no visible neighbors — just you and the sounds of nature - Miles of hiking trails winding through deep woods and rolling hills - Access to Red Lick Creek for wading, agate and geode hunting or simply relaxing by the water - Incredible stargazing—far from city light pollution - Wildlife watching and the chance to visit our working farm with friendly animals
Red Haven Farm Benefits: - Browse our on-farm store, stocked with pasture-raised beef, pork, goat meat, chicken, and eggs, plus handmade goods and items from other local farms - Fridge-stocking service available so you can unwind the moment you arrive - Schedule a personal, guided farm tour to learn about your animals and sustainable farm practices, while getting up close and personal with our furry friends. Get the most out of your time on the farm. - Schedule a guided agate/geode hunt to find some of the special rocks which Estill County is known for - Private picnic sites along the creeks
While the cabin offers peaceful seclusion, you're just a short drive from several top destinations: - Close to Berea, Tater Knob and the local artisans, shops and additional hiking opportunities within 15 miles - Red River Gorge is Just over an hour away. This dramatic landscape in Daniel Boone National Forest features towering sandstone cliffs, natural arches, 600+ miles of hiking, climbs, ziplines, and the famous Natural Bridge State Resort Park - One hour to Lexington including Keeneland and the Horse Park
It is necessary to cross a small creek so low profile cars are not recommended, but once you're on the property, you may never want to leave. Parking is conveniently located right at the cabin
